If \(A=\{r,s\}\) and \(B=\{u,v,w\}\), what is the set of second components in \(A\times B\)?

Explanation opens after your attempt
Correct Answer

A. ({u,v,w})

Step 1

Concept

Second components always come from (B). If (A) is non-empty, every element of (B) appears as a second component.

Step 2

Why this answer is correct

The correct answer is A. ({u,v,w}). Second components always come from (B). If (A) is non-empty, every element of (B) appears as a second component.
